Valued policy laws are designed to protect insureds from an insurer’s claim of underinsurance after a loss. They generally apply only to buildings and structures, and only to losses due to perils specified in the law. These laws vary by state, and it is important for insurers to be aware of how the law can affect them.

Global natural disaster events to the end of Q3 2022 caused total economic losses estimated minimally at $227 billion, of which $99 billion was covered by public and private insurers. Insured losses will now top $100 billion for the third year in a row. This represents an insurance protection gap of 56%, according to a recent report from Aon. PropertyCasualty360 (10/20/2022)
Higher claims costs driven by inflation coupled with more frequent claims driven by climate change have had a toll on reinsurers. Since reinsurance rates affect P&C policy, as reinsurers struggle with waning profitability, their struggles promise to play an even bigger role in the cost of nearly every policy in the near- to medium-term.
